ABN AMRO Bank N.V. trimmed its position in AbbVie Inc. (NYSE:ABBV – Free Report) by 5.4% in the first qu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und owned 864,389 shares of the company’s stock after selling 49,474 shares during the period. AbbVie accounts for approximately 2.0% of ABN AMRO Bank N.V.’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 17th biggest position. ABN AMRO Bank N.V.’s holdings in AbbVie were worth $189,798,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

AbbVie Dividend Announcement
The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, August 14th. Investors of record on Wednesday, July 15th will be issued a $1.73 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Wednesday, July 15th. This represents a $6.92 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.8%. AbbVie’s payout ratio is presently 340.89%.

- Positive Sentiment: AbbVie said the FDA approved Skyrizi for pediatric use in psoriatic disease, making it the first and only IL-23 inhibitor in the U.S. approved for children six years and older weighing less than 40 kg with plaque psoriasis or psoriatic arthritis. The expansion broadens the drug’s addressable market and supports long-term sales growth. Article: SKYRIZI® (risankizumab-rzaa) Now FDA Approved for Pediatric Use in Psoriatic Disease

AbbVie Profile
AbbVie is a global, research-driven biopharmaceutical company that was created as a spin-off from Abbott Laboratories in 2013 and is headquartered in North Chicago, Illinois. The company focuses on discovering, developing and commercializing therapies for complex and often chronic medical conditions. Its operations span research and development, manufacturing, regulatory affairs and commercialization, with an emphasis on bringing specialty medicines to market across multiple therapeutic areas.
AbbVie’s product portfolio and pipeline cover several major therapeutic categories, including immunology, oncology, neuroscience, virology and women’s health.
